About Baltasar Gracian

Baltasar Gracian was Spanish jesuit and baroque prose writer and philosopher. Baltasar Gracián y Morales, better known as Baltasar Gracián, was a Spanish Jesuit priest and Baroque prose writer and philosopher. He was born in Belmonte, near Calatayud (Aragón). Read more on Wikipedia →
